Marys

Research has shown us that the most popular female name in pop music from the 50s to the 70s is Mary. This week’s program includes the well known song ‘Proud Mary’ from Credence Clearwater Revival and the not so well known song ‘Mary Mary’ from Australia’s top male singer of the sixties – Normie Rowe. The Aussie highlight is another virtually unknown Melbourne band, Changing Times with their cover of ‘Mary Lou’.
